Features at a Glance

Key components: Dual CCD sensors, Dual Fujinon lenses, 3.5-inch 3D LCD, Built-in flash, Memory card slot, HDMI output, USB connector.

FeatureDescription
Dual CCD SensorsTwo 10-megapixel sensors for capturing 3D images
Dual Fujinon Lenses3x optical zoom lenses synchronized for 3D capture
3.5-inch 3D LCDParallax barrier display for glasses-free 3D viewing
3D/2D Mode SwitchToggle between 3D and conventional 2D photography
HD Video Recording720p HD video in both 3D and 2D modes
Built-in FlashAuto flash with red-eye reduction
Memory Card SlotSD/SDHC card compatibility
HDMI OutputMini HDMI port for direct TV connection
USB ConnectorFor computer connection and charging
Battery CompartmentFor NP-50 rechargeable lithium-ion battery

Controls and Settings

Access menus via MENU button. Main Controls: Power switch, Shutter button, Mode dial, Zoom lever, Navigation buttons.

Mode Dial: AUTO, PROGRAM, MANUAL, NATURAL LIGHT, NATURAL LIGHT & FLASH, SP (Scene Position), MOVIE.

Shooting Settings: Image size (10M/5M/3M), Quality (FINE/NORMAL), ISO (AUTO/100-1600), White Balance, Flash modes. Playback: 3D/2D viewing, Slideshow, Protect, Delete, DPOF printing. Setup: Date/Time, Language, Format, Power Save, Beep, LCD Brightness.

Shooting Modes

Supports various shooting modes for different scenarios.

  1. AUTO Mode: Fully automatic settings for point-and-shoot operation.
  2. PROGRAM Mode: Automatic exposure with manual settings access.
  3. MANUAL Mode: Full control over aperture and shutter speed.
  4. NATURAL LIGHT: Shoot without flash in low light conditions.
  5. SP Mode: Scene presets (Portrait, Landscape, Sport, Night, etc.)
  6. MOVIE Mode: Record 720p HD video in 3D or 2D.
  7. 3D ADVANCED: Advanced 3D settings for professional results.
  8. 2D Mode: Traditional two-dimensional photography.

WARNING! Maintain proper distance from subjects for optimal 3D effect. Avoid extreme close-ups in 3D mode.

Troubleshooting

SymptomPossible CauseCorrective Action
Camera won't turn onBattery depleted/incorrectCharge battery; ensure proper installation.
Poor 3D effectSubject distance/lightingMaintain 1m-5m distance; ensure adequate lighting.
Memory card errorCard damaged/not formattedFormat card in camera; try different card.
Blurry imagesCamera shake/focusUse tripod in low light; ensure proper focus.
No 3D on TVTV compatibility/connectionsEnsure TV supports 3D; check HDMI connection.
Battery drains quicklySettings/ageReduce LCD brightness; turn off when not in use; replace old battery.

Reset: Menu > Setup > Reset to restore default settings.
